Types of Glass for Bifold Doors

When it pertains to selecting replacement glass for your [bifold door refurbishment](https://doodleordie.com/profile/zincwind9) doors, there are several choices to consider. Here are a few of the most popular kinds of glass:
Low-E Glass: Low-E (Low Emissivity) glass is a type of energy-efficient glass that assists to lower heat transfer between the inside your home and outdoors. This type of glass is perfect for property owners who wish to decrease their energy costs and reduce their carbon footprint.Tempered Glass: Tempered glass, also known as toughened glass, is a type of security glass that is created to shatter into small, blunt fragments in case of damage. This kind of glass is perfect for house owners with young kids or family pets.Laminated Glass: Laminated glass is a type of shatterproof glass that consists of two or more panes of glass separated by a layer of plastic. This type of glass is ideal for homeowners who desire to reduce the danger of injury in the occasion of damage.Solar Glass: Solar glass is a kind of glass that is designed to reduce the amount of UV rays that enter your home. This kind of glass is ideal for homeowners who desire to minimize the danger of fading and staining of their furniture and carpets.
